trains

Yesterday I went to take a train to the woods in the west of the city, but for some reason there were no trains. As I stood on the platform waiting, I read in the book I had taken with me to read on the train about a woman on a train who said that she would like to look longer at the small, abandoned train stations but the train stopped there for only one or at most two minutes. Actually, there were trains, but not to where I wanted to go and despite the schedule as well as the fact that I had taken these trains many times before at the same time. The passage in the book following the one about the woman on the train was about sheep, but I was too distressed about the missing trains to pay attention. In the end, I ended up taking a train back home, wondering if the cellist would be playing at the station near me. He wasn't.
